vs.

Grok vs. Perplexity

What's the Difference?

Grok and Perplexity are both tools used in natural language processing, but they have different focuses. Grok is a platform that helps users understand and analyze text data, providing insights and visualizations to help make sense of the information. On the other hand, Perplexity is a metric used to evaluate the performance of language models, measuring how well a model predicts the next word in a sequence of text. While Grok is more geared towards data analysis and visualization, Perplexity is specifically used to assess the accuracy and effectiveness of language models.

Comparison

AttributeGrokPerplexity
DefinitionIntuitive understanding or comprehensionA measure of how well a probability distribution predicts a sample
OriginCoined by Robert A. Heinlein in his novel "Stranger in a Strange Land"Originated in information theory and natural language processing
UsageCommonly used in psychology and personal developmentPrimarily used in machine learning and language modeling
SubjectivitySubjective and personal understandingObjective measure of model performance

Further Detail

Introduction

Grok and Perplexity are two popular tools used in the field of natural language processing (NLP). While both tools are designed to help with language understanding and processing, they have distinct attributes that set them apart. In this article, we will compare the features of Grok and Perplexity to help you understand which tool may be better suited for your needs.

Accuracy

One of the key factors to consider when comparing Grok and Perplexity is their accuracy in language processing. Grok is known for its high accuracy in understanding and interpreting natural language, making it a reliable tool for tasks such as sentiment analysis and text classification. On the other hand, Perplexity also boasts impressive accuracy rates, especially in tasks like language modeling and speech recognition. Both tools have been extensively tested and proven to deliver accurate results.

Speed

Another important aspect to consider is the speed at which Grok and Perplexity can process language data. Grok is known for its fast processing speed, making it ideal for real-time applications where quick responses are crucial. Perplexity, on the other hand, may not be as fast as Grok in processing large volumes of data, but it still offers decent speed for most NLP tasks. Depending on your specific needs, you may prioritize either speed or accuracy when choosing between Grok and Perplexity.

Flexibility

Flexibility is another factor to consider when comparing Grok and Perplexity. Grok is known for its flexibility in handling various types of language data, making it a versatile tool for a wide range of NLP tasks. Perplexity, on the other hand, may be more specialized in certain areas of language processing, such as speech recognition or machine translation. Depending on the complexity and diversity of your language data, you may find Grok to be more suitable for your needs.

Ease of Use

When it comes to ease of use, Grok and Perplexity have different user interfaces and learning curves. Grok is designed to be user-friendly, with intuitive features and a simple interface that makes it easy for beginners to get started. Perplexity, on the other hand, may have a steeper learning curve due to its more advanced features and customization options. If you are looking for a tool that is easy to use out of the box, Grok may be the better choice for you.

Cost

Cost is another important consideration when comparing Grok and Perplexity. Grok is a commercial tool that may require a subscription or licensing fee for full access to its features. Perplexity, on the other hand, may offer a free or open-source version with limited features, as well as paid options for more advanced capabilities. Depending on your budget and the specific features you need, you may choose Grok or Perplexity based on their cost and pricing models.

Integration

Integration with other tools and platforms is crucial for seamless workflow in NLP tasks. Grok and Perplexity both offer integration options with popular programming languages and frameworks, as well as APIs for connecting to external systems. Grok, for example, may have pre-built integrations with common NLP libraries like NLTK or spaCy. Perplexity, on the other hand, may offer custom integration options for specific use cases. Depending on your existing tech stack and integration requirements, you may prefer Grok or Perplexity for their compatibility with other tools.

Conclusion

In conclusion, Grok and Perplexity are both powerful tools for language processing, each with its own strengths and weaknesses. Grok excels in accuracy and speed, making it a reliable choice for real-time applications. Perplexity, on the other hand, may offer more specialized features and customization options for specific NLP tasks. Ultimately, the choice between Grok and Perplexity will depend on your specific needs, budget, and integration requirements. We hope this comparison has helped you understand the attributes of Grok and Perplexity better, so you can make an informed decision for your language processing tasks.

Comparisons may contain inaccurate information about people, places, or facts. Please report any issues.